Part Number VCA8500IRGCTG4 |
Category Linear - Amplifiers - Instrumentation, OP Amps, Buffer Amps |
Manufacturer Texas Instruments |
Description IC OPAMP VGA 8 CIRCUIT 64VQFN |
Package Cut Tape (CT) |
Series - |
Operating Temperature -40°C ~ 85°C |
Mounting Type Surface Mount |
Package / Case 64-VFQFN Exposed Pad |
Supplier Device Package 64-VQFN (9x9) |
Current - Supply 10µA |
Output Type Differential |
Number of Circuits 8 |
Voltage - Supply, Single/Dual (±) 3.15V ~ 3.6V, 4.75V ~ 5.25V |
Current - Output / Channel 20 mA |
-3db Bandwidth 55 MHz |
Amplifier Type Variable Gain |
Current - Input Bias - |
Voltage - Input Offset 1 mV |
Slew Rate - |
Gain Bandwidth Product 15 MHz |
